What is Category B?
Classification B, typically referred to as the "car and small van" classification, is a type of driving license that allows the holder to drive cars as much as 3,500 kgs (kg) in weight, including small vans and pickup trucks. This classification is especially crucial for individuals who need to drive for individual or professional reasons, as it covers most of lorries utilized in everyday life.

Theory Test
The theory test is a vital step in the procedure. It includes two parts: a multiple-choice area and a risk understanding test.Multiple-Choice Section: This part evaluates the candidate's understanding of the Highway Code, roadway signs, and safe driving practices. The test consists of 50 concerns, and applicants should score a minimum of 43 out of 50 to pass.Risk Perception Test: This section assesses the candidate's ability to recognize and respond to potential risks on the road. The test includes 14 video clips, and candidates need to score a minimum of 44 out of 75 to pass.
Practical Test
When the theory test is passed, the candidate can book a useful driving test. The practical test is designed to examine the candidate's ability to drive securely and effectively on different kinds of roadways.Driving Skills: The test includes a series of maneuvers such as reversing around a corner, parallel parking, and an emergency stop.Independent Driving: The candidate will also be required to drive independently, following directions from a sat nav or traffic indications.General Driving: The inspector will assess the candidate's general driving abilities, including their ability to follow the guidelines of the road, handle speed, and handle the lorry safely.Preparing for the Exam
